Heritage in storms and floods

|

Faced with the impact of extreme weather such as storms, floods and landslides, the country's invaluable cultural heritages, symbols of history and national identity, are facing the risk of being destroyed or permanently disappeared. The current status of heritage conservation in Vietnam is still largely in a "reactive" state. This work focuses on reinforcing and providing emergency support when natural disasters and floods are about to occur and overcoming the consequences.
